So last weekend, my friend Guy celebrated his birthday by getting a group of friends together to spend a day on Catalina Island. Now, I’ve lived in L.A. for twenty years and I had never been to Catalina. The closest I’ve come is watching films put out by Catalina Home Video -- like The Best Little Warehouse in L.A. for example -- but that’s not the same as going to Catalina. For starters, no one has a boat in Warehouse. They just have box cutters and big, big bulges.

dennis_catharbor_320x240.jpg

On the ferry ride over we played the home game of "Family Feud" that my friend Jack brought. One question was "name a Michael Jackson song?" Shockingly, “Dirty Diana” made the top 10 yet “P.Y.T.” and “Smooth Criminal” were nowhere to be found. That’s surprising, right? I can’t even think of how “Dirty Diana” goes. I was pleased to note, however, that none of MJ’s shamelessly gimmicky duets from the 80’s like “The Girl is Mine,” “Say Say Say” and “State of Shock,” made the cut. Yes, they were huge hits but they sucked and we all knew it at the time. It’s as if the second those songs ended their chart runs they evaporated into thin air.

dennis_feud_320x240.jpg

On a related note, I heard a rumor recently that Michael Jackson was reaching out to Paula Abdul with an eye toward collaborating. To that I say, 'Oh, if only.' I think he should write a song for her called, “Pro-Tools, Take the Wheel.” I think Paula 2007 is more afraid of singing than she is terrorism.
